Answer: D) 0.733.
Step-by-step explanation:
Let C denotes the number of employees having college degree and S denote the number of employees are single.
We are given ,
Total = 600 , n(C)=400 , n(S)=100 , n(C∩S)=60
Then,
[tex]n(C\cup S)=n(C)+n(S)-n(C\cap S)\\\\=400+100-60=440[/tex]
Now, the probability that an employee of the company is single or has a college degree is
[tex]P(C\cup S)=\dfrac{n(C\cup S)}{\text{Total}}\\\\=\dfrac{440}{600}=0.733333333\approx0.733[/tex]
Hence, the probability that an employee of the company is single or has a college degree is 0.733
